titleOfInvention 3D printing sound guide pad material, sound guide pad, method and device for 3D printing sound guide pad
abstract The present invention provides a 3D printing sound guide pad material, a sound guide pad, and a method and device for 3D printing a sound guide pad. The 3D printing sound guide pad material is composed of the following components: 8%-10% polyvinyl alcohol, 1%-2% agar, 5-8% glycerol, 0.01%-0.1% preservative and the balance of ultrapure water. The sound guide pad obtained by using the above 3D printed sound guide pad material not only has good mechanical properties and acoustic properties, but also has similar impedance to the human body, has good biocompatibility, good moisturizing effect, no irritation to the skin, and can be recycled.
